Below are > > the output of the commands you asked me to input > > > $$$$$---------------------quote begin------------------------$$$ > > LIJIANG:~# dpkg -l hotplug udev | grep -v '^[D|+]' > > rc hotplug 0.0.20040329-26 Linux Hotplug Scripts > > ii udev 0.105-4 /dev/ and hotplug management daemon > > LIJIANG:~# ls -l /dev/input/by-path/ > > ls: /dev/input/by-path/: No such file or directory > > $$$$$---------------------quote end------------------------$$$ > > > What shold I do now? > > You need to purge the hotplug package; it has been removed when your > kernel and udev were upgraded, but its configuration files are still > present and they are known to cause problems with the new udev. (There > should have been a message about this, but it is easy to overlook it > when you are doing an upgrade of many packages.) > > Run > > dpkg --purge hotplug > > as root. After that the status of hotplug should be "pn" instead of > "rc". Reboot and see if the mouse works.
